Official biography
Irma Pérez was appointed as an immigration judge to begin hearing cases in August 2023. Judge Pérez ear ned a Bachelor of Arts in 2004 from Georgetown University and a Juris Doctor in 2011 from the University of California Law San Francisco (formerly University of California Hastings College of the Law). From 2015 to 2023, she was in private practice at the Law Office of Irma Pérez PC in Pasadena, California, practic ing before EOIR, the Department of Homeland Security (DHS), and the Department of State (DOS). From 2012 to 2015, she was an associate with Daniel Shanfield Immigration Defense PC in San Jose, California, represent ing noncitizens before EOIR, DHS and DOS. Judge Pérez is a member of the State Bar of California.
